PANAMA

 
government: constitutional democracy
state of civil and political rights: Free
constitution: 11 October 1972; major reforms adopted 1978, 1983, 1994, and 2004
legal system: based on civil law system; judicial review of legislative acts in the Supreme Court of Justice; five superior courts; three courts of appeal
legislative system: Unicameral Legislative Assembly
judicial system: Supreme Court of Justice
religion: 85% Catholic; 15% Protestant
